Skip to content
BetterOpenSource

Lobe Chat vs Ollama

A side-by-side comparison of two open-source tools to help you choose the right one.

Feature
SummaryA beautiful, extensible AI chat framework.Run open LLMs locally with a single command.
GitHub stars56K175K
LicenseSource AvailableMIT
LanguageTypeScriptGo
PricingFree & Open SourceFree & Open Source
Self-hostable
ReplacesChatGPT, ClaudeChatGPT, Claude
Rating4.6 / 54.9 / 5

Lobe Chat features

  • Plugin marketplace and custom assistant store
  • Text-to-speech and speech-to-text
  • Multi-modal vision support
  • Installable PWA with polished UI
  • One-click deploy to Vercel or Docker

Ollama features

  • One-command model download and run (e.g. `ollama run llama3.3`)
  • Built-in OpenAI-compatible REST API for local apps
  • Runs open models — Llama, DeepSeek, Qwen, Gemma, Mistral — on CPU or GPU
  • GPU acceleration on NVIDIA, AMD, and Apple Silicon
  • Custom models and prompts via Modelfiles, plus a large model library

Lobe Chatpros & cons

Pros

  • Best-in-class visual design
  • Rich plugin ecosystem
  • Trivial to deploy

Cons

  • Some advanced features assume cloud deployment
  • License has usage conditions for commercial hosting

Ollamapros & cons

Pros

  • Dead-simple setup — a model is running in one command
  • Powers popular front-ends like Open WebUI and editors like Continue and Aider
  • Fully offline and private; nothing leaves your machine

Cons

  • Model quality and speed depend on your local hardware
  • Ships as a CLI and API — pair it with a front-end for a graphical chat UI

Command Palette

Search for a command to run...